[ ] Step 4 — Re-key the websocket layer. Since Meshloaf plugins can toggle per-message deflate, the key ceremony covers both compressed and raw channels — don't skip one because compression "probably isn't on." Once both custodians have tapped in, the ceremony tool will ask for the recovery passphrase before sealing the new keys; it's printed right below.

vault phrase of bagaf-kajeg = jorath-feniel-briir-siliel-ralix

### Account Recovery — Catalogue Import (Lintwood)

Quick one for review: when the Lintwood catalogue import wipes a patron's session table, the recovery flow re-seeds accounts from the nightly snapshot. Check that the importer skips locked accounts — last time it didn't. To rerun recovery against staging you'll need the vault passphrase, which is appended just below.

recovery phrase for yafof-tajof: julmir-kelax-julvan-holath-belvan-holir-ralael-ralvan-ralath-julvan-silmir-istmir-kaswyn-ulamir

### TCK-2291: Signature check failing on scaler rollout

The Hollowpine queue-depth autoscaler rejects the v2.3 bundle with a bad-signature error. Likely cause: bundle was signed after last week's rotation but agents still pin the old key. Requesting security review before we repin. For reference, the key the bundle was signed with is below.

release key, yagap-kagag: bky6_1ks93y

Step 2 — Bloom filter warm-up (Quillcache)

Before traffic hits the key-value store, the bloom filter needs seeding, otherwise every miss goes straight to disk and support gets paged. Set BLOOM_BITS=24 and BLOOM_HASHES=7 in the env file. The seeder also needs the store's admin token, so add that line next.

sealed setting: ARCHIVE_KEY3=8d0